1. Hydrate, Hydrate, Hydrate
Drinking alcohol dehydrates your body, leading to hangovers. The first and foremost step to recovering from a hangover is to hydrate yourself. Drinking water, coconut water or green juices can help you in this process. These fluids will not only hydrate your body, but they will also help flush out the toxins from your system.

2. Get Some Rest
Sleep is the ultimate cure for any hangover. It is vital to allow your body to rest and recover after a night out. Getting a good night’s sleep or even a short nap can work wonders in helping you feel refreshed and energized.

3. Eat Nutritious Foods
Eating nutrient-rich foods like fruits, vegetables, and whole grains is essential to reviving your body after a hangover. These foods contain essential vitamins and minerals that aid in replenishing your body’s electrolytes lost due to alcohol consumption.

4. Sweat it Out
Exercise can be a great way to sweat out the toxins from your body. It may seem difficult to exercise after a night of partying, but a light cardio session, yoga poses, or a jog can go a long way in rejuvenating your body.

5. Avoid Alcohol
The most effective way to avoid a hangover is to avoid drinking alcohol. However, if you do indulge in alcoholic drinks, make sure to limit your intake and opt for healthier drink options like vodka soda or white wine.
